Price Range & Condition
The condition of a property plays an important role in determining its value, with the degree of impact varying by property type, size and location.
For 44, Coniston Road, Birmingham, we estimate a market value of £231,575 and a rental value of £1,462 per month when presented in very good decorative order. Should the property require extensive cosmetic improvement, those figures would reduce to £205,109 and £1,295 per month respectively.

Sold Prices
The most recent sale of 44, Coniston Road, Birmingham completed on 24th January 2018 at £150,520 and was recorded by HM Land Registry as a freehold house.
Since 1995 this is the property's only sale.
Values of comparable properties have risen by 54.8% over the period since January 2018.
